gpt4 book ai didi

javascript - 在下载的 html 文件中访问 c​​ordova 插件

转载 作者:行者123 更新时间:2023-11-29 12:28:53 25 4
gpt4 key购买 nike

我有一个要求,我需要从服务器下载一些 HTML 文件并在 Cordova Webview 中打开它们。

我在从这些下载的文件中访问插件时遇到了挑战。

我需要在我的 <script> 中放置什么路径下载的 HTML 文件的标签以访问与应用程序一起打包在 asset/www/文件夹下的 Cordova Plugin JS 文件?

我可以将 file:///android_asset/www/cordova.js 放在我的 HTML 中吗?

我可以使用 loadDataWithBaseURL 代替 loadURL 吗?

如果不是,它的等价物是什么?

还需要 iOS 环境的答案。

急需解答。

更新:我正在加载我下载的文件,如

loadUrl("file://"+pathToInternalStorage_Index.html");

在我的 HTML 中我放了

<script src="file:///android_asset/www/cordova.js></script>

现在,当我打开下载的文件时,我会弹出 EditText,上面写着“gap_init:2”单击“确定”后,我在控制台中收到 CordovaWebview 错误:超时错误!

插件错误是:“错误:找不到方法........(文件:///android_asset/www/cordova.js:927:44)........

最佳答案

<script src="file:///android_asset/www/cordova.js></script>

解决了这个问题。还要确保正确构建 cordova 项目。

关于javascript - 在下载的 html 文件中访问 c​​ordova 插件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28336573/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com